MONTEVALLO, Ala. | The UAH volleyball team swept their fifth straight Gulf South Conference road contest of the season as they defeated Montevallo 3-0 (25-23, 25-19, 25-17).
The Chargers improved to 17-2 (8-1 GSC) with the win, while the Falcons fell to 8-11 (5-4 GSC). The victory marked the 11th sweep of the season for the Blue & White.
The first set was the most contested set of the evening, with the Falcons holding a six point advantage at one point at 12-6 before a 12-to-6 run to knot things up at 18-18. UAH finished the set with 15 kills and five blocks.
Caroline Moyer led the Charger attack with 10 kills and a .280 hitting percentage.
Autumn Mayes had the second highest kill total at nine, while the senior also had six digs and a block assist.
Kayla Ward and
Mary Grace Bundrant put on a blocking clinic in Tuesday evening's match as the pair paced a 12 block performance by the Chargers. The duo rank first and second in the GSC in blocks per set this season.
Tatiana Bonilla had 11 digs to lead UAH, while
Savannah Rutledge and
Kelsey Gasaway combined for 27 assists.
